CALL FOR PAPERS
The planning committee of the 15th North American Mine Ventilation Symposium cordially
invites papers from professionals in all areas of mine ventilation including: industry, academia,
government, and education. All papers will be peer reviewed by at least two reviewers.
Symposium topics include, but are not limited to:
Diesel Emissions Control and
Measurement
Dust Control
Economics
Heat and Humidity
Mine Fans
Mine Fires and Emergency Response
Mine Gases
Monitoring and VOD
Numerical Modeling
Occupational Health
Stoppings and Seals
Spontaneous Combustion
Tunnel Ventilation Planning and Design
Ventilation Education
Ventilation en Español
Ventilation Planning
Ventilation Survey Techniques
